To begin, understanding the general requirements for securing construction loans is essential. These typically include a minimum credit score of around 680 or higher, as lenders assess your financial stability. You'll also need to provide a detailed project budget, evidence of sufficient down payment (often ranging from 3% to 20% of the total project cost), and documentation for the property's appraised value. Additionally, lenders evaluate the loan-to-value (LTV) ratio, which can go up to 70% based on the after-repair value (ARV), ensuring the project is feasible and aligns with local market conditions in Calabasas.
Proper financial preparation plays a pivotal role in the funding process. Before applying, prepare a comprehensive business plan that includes your project timeline, detailed cost estimates for labor, materials, permits, and any potential contingencies. This preparation not only demonstrates your readiness but also helps in negotiating better terms. For instance, having a solid financial profile can lead to more favorable interest rates, which might range from 7% to 18% APR depending on the loan specifics. We recommend focusing on your overall financial health, such as maintaining stable income and minimizing existing debts, to streamline the approval process.

Calculating Loan Payments for Constructions
In Calabasas, California, estimating loan payments for construction projects is essential for effective financial planning. This process helps you understand the costs involved and make informed decisions.
Key factors in loan calculations include interest rates, which can fluctuate based on market conditions and your credit profile, as well as loan terms such as the duration of the loan (e.g., 15 to 30 years) and the total loan amount. Other elements like down payment size and property type also play a role in determining your monthly obligations. Understanding payment structures, such as interest-only payments during the construction phase, is vital for effective budgeting. This knowledge aids in managing cash flow and ensuring your project stays on track financially.
